Texas A&M anthropologist helps identify new species of Homo-like fossil found in South Africa

Thursday, April 8, 2010 - 11:21 in Paleontology & Archaeology

COLLEGE STATION, April 8, 2010 - Two well-preserved skeletons of a human ancestor never before seen have been discovered in South Africa by a team that includes a Texas A&M University anthropologist.
